Aaiyash: The Desire is one of those films that lingers in the shadows of the crime drama genre. The story revolves around Vicky, this charming yet morally ambiguous character, who gets tangled in a kidnapping scheme orchestrated by Mrs. Modi. It’s really interesting how the narrative shifts; you start with this intent to exploit, but as Vicky interacts with Sweta, the dynamics change completely. The pacing is uneven at times, but it mirrors the chaos of Vicky's life. There’s an intriguing mix of tension and romance that unfolds, and the performances are gritty, giving it an edge. The film doesn’t rely heavily on flashy effects but rather on the raw emotions of the characters. It’s definitely worth a watch for anyone interested in crime dramas with a twist.
Themes of moral ambiguity and unexpected love.Gritty performances that enhance the drama.An uneven pacing that reflects the turmoil within the characters.
